Ingredients

ROASTED PUMPKIN SEEDS (SHELLED PUMPKIN SEEDS, ORGANIC OLEIC SUNFLOWER OIL), ORGANIC TEQUILA LIME SEASONING (SEA SALT, ORGANIC MALTODEXTRIN, ORGANIC TAPIOCA DEXTROSE, ORGANIC DEHYDRATED CHILI PEPPER, ORGANIC CANE SUGAR [ORGANIC CANE SUGAR, ORGANIC CORNSTARCH], ORGANIC VINEGAR POWDER [ORGANIC MALTODEXTRIN, ORGANIC WHITE DISTILLED VINEGAR], ORGANIC DEHYDRATED SPICES, ORGANIC ONION POWDER, ORGANIC GARLIC POWDER, CONTAINS 2% OR LESS OF CITRIC ACID, ORGANIC SUNFLOWER OIL, NATURAL TEQUILA FLAVOR, LIME OIL), ORGANIC OLEIC SUNFOWER OIL.

Calorie Analysis

The food TEQUILA LIME FLAVORED PEPITAS, TEQUILA LIME, based on the serving size listed above, would account for 9% of your daily allotted calories based on a 2,000 calorie diet. The majority of the calories for this food comes from fat. Fat makes up 70% of the calories.
